Anonymous 04/29/2016 (Fri) 14:23:02 No. 568
So, I just bought this today of of dlsite. I was thinking that it was in english, and overlooked that it was still in japanese. (due to all the other ones other than the collab being in english)

Is there any plan on there being and english release?